Homemade Sour Watermelon Gummies

Prep time: 15 mins Total time: 45 mins

Serves: 24 + individual gummy candies

These sour watermelon gummies are positively good for you, made with grass fed gelatin and fresh watermelon. The sour kick comes from fresh lemon juice.

Ingredients

4 cups fresh watermelon, cut into chunks (or 2 cups juice)

6 tbl grass fed gelatin

½ cup freshly squeezed lemon juice

Optional, depending on the sweetness / ripeness of your watermelon: ¼ cup raw honey

Instructions

Add the fresh watermelon to a blender and liquefy.

Strain the blended watermelon through a fine mesh strainer, discarding the pulp - you should have about 2 cups of juice.

Skim the small amount of white foam from the top of the watermelon juice and discard.

Divide the juice: add half to a small saucepan and the other half to a bowl.

Add the grass fed gelatin to the juice in the bowl by sprinkling it over the surface. Let it sit for a few minutes so that it dissolves into the juice. It will solidify.

Gently heat the watermelon juice in the saucepan just to warm it - do not bring it to a boil or simmer.

Add the gelatin & juice mixture to the rest of the juice in the saucepan. Whisk or stir to combine until the liquid is smooth.

Add the raw honey and lemon juice; whisk until dissolved and combined.

Pour the gelatin mixture into molds or a refrigerator safe pan.

Chill until set, about 30 minutes and then either remove the gelatin from the mold or slice it into pieces.

Can be stored at room temperature, although they are great cold.
